When we planned the layout of the house we decided that the biggest bedroom would be the office and one of the back bedrooms would be our bedroom. Indeed the back bedroom is smaller but it gets the most beautiful morning and evening light. You know the type of light that dims your eyes.
It’s no coincidence really that the paint we choose for the bedroom is called First Light, resembling the essence of light at dawn. But what I love most about this room is how bedding can change the feel of it. Combining a nuance of ice-cold lemon sorbet, neutral grey-beige and a pinky-peachy dusky colour just embodies everything that summer means to me.
And when I lay in the softest sheets with the golden evening light shining up the whole room, listening to the ocean waves outside of the bedroom window all I can think about is this poem:
